Rooftop solar in Udaipur, Rajasthan

A standard residential rooftop solar system in Udaipur sizes between 1 kW and 5 kW depending on monthly consumption. Most Udaipur homeowners pick a 3 kW system — it covers 300–400 units a month and captures the full ₹78,000 PM-Surya Ghar central subsidy.

Installed cost for a 3 kW system runs ₹1.8 lakh to ₹2.4 lakh; after the central subsidy your net outlay is ₹1.0 lakh to ₹1.6 lakh. Payback typically lands between 3.5 and 5 years — and the panels carry a 25-year warranty. The installer handles the PM-Surya Ghar registration, DISCOM net-metering application, system installation, and commissioning. Confirm AMC terms, panel warranty (look for Tier-1 manufacturer + 25-year linear-power guarantee), and inverter warranty (10 years minimum) before signing.

What to check before booking

  • Site visit and shading analysis — this determines the realistic kW your roof can support
  • PM-Surya Ghar registration done on your behalf, with the ₹78,000 subsidy credited directly to your bank
  • DISCOM net-metering application and commissioning — installer should handle this end-to-end
  • Tier-1 panels with 25-year linear-power warranty (degradation ≤0.55% per year)
  • Inverter warranty (10 years minimum) and on-site replacement policy
  • AMC contract for at least 5 years (panel cleaning, performance check, inverter health)

Frequently asked questions

How much PM-Surya Ghar subsidy can I get in Udaipur?

PM-Surya Ghar: Muft Bijli Yojana offers up to ₹78,000 for a residential rooftop solar system (₹30,000 per kW for the first 2 kW, ₹18,000 for the 3rd kW). Most households choose a 3 kW system to capture the full subsidy. Rajasthan residents apply through the national pmsuryaghar.gov.in portal — your DISCOM and the installer handle the rest.

What's the typical cost of a 3 kW system in Udaipur?

A 3 kW grid-connected residential rooftop system costs ₹1.8 lakh to ₹2.4 lakh installed (₹60,000 – ₹80,000 per kW). After the ₹78,000 PM-Surya Ghar subsidy, your net cost is ₹1.0 lakh to ₹1.6 lakh. Payback for a typical household in Rajasthan is 3.5 – 5 years; the panels carry a 25-year warranty.

What panels and inverters does Choudhary Solar Energy(Choudhary Enterprises) typically install?

For PM-Surya Ghar eligibility, panels must be from approved manufacturers — typically Tier-1 brands such as Adani, Vikram, Waaree, Tata Power Solar, Premier Energies, or Loom Solar. Inverters are usually Growatt, Solis, Microtek, Polycab, or Luminous. Ask for the specific model and the 25-year linear-power warranty document.

How long does installation take?

Typical timeline: 3 days for site survey + design, 10–20 days for DISCOM approval, 1–2 days for installation, 7–15 days for net-meter installation and commissioning. End-to-end is 4–8 weeks for most residential installations in Udaipur.
